Heavy Equipment Operator Jobs in Kansas City, MO
A Heavy Equipment Operator in the construction industry operates large machinery, such as bulldozers, excavators, and cranes, which are utilized for construction projects. Their key responsibilities include maneuvering heavy equipment safely and efficiently, performing basic maintenance checks, and ensuring the machinery is in good working order. They are essential to the construction process as they clear and grade land, excavate earth, lift heavy materials, and perform other tasks that require specialized equipment. They also should have a thorough understanding of safety protocols and procedures to prevent accidents on the job site.
Potential Heavy Equipment Operators should possess excellent hand-eye coordination, physical stamina, technical skills, and mechanical knowledge. They should also understand how to read blueprints and topographic maps. It's crucial for them to have certification from a recognized heavy equipment operator training school, and some states may require a commercial driver's license (CDL). Before becoming a Heavy Equipment Operator, a person may have roles such as a Construction Laborer, Forklift Operator, or Truck Driver. These positions can provide valuable experience in the construction industry, and help individuals gain familiarity with different types of machinery.
